Insurance

Mesothelioma sufferers could be eligible for different types of insurance coverage to assist in paying for treatment. These benefits can give peace of mind to families during a difficult time. Individuals with mesothelioma are advised to look into their options, and speak with a mesothelioma attorney to get additional advice.

In addition to private insurance, mesothelioma patients could be eligible for government-run programs such as Medicare and Medicaid. These insurance plans are aimed at seniors and those with low incomes.

These programs are available to patients who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ma, and are not able to work due to the disease. The funds can be used to help pay for medical treatment and other expenses. In some cases, mesothelioma victims can also receive compensation from an unjustified death claim against the company that caused their exposure to asbestos.

Group health insurance is a different kind of insurance that is available to mesothelioma patients. It is a type of insurance that is typically provided by employers to their employees. These policies are different from private health insurance because they are designed for the entire company, rather than for each employee separately. This means that patients suffering from mesothelioma won't be denied coverage or charged higher premiums.

If a mesothelioma patient is able to work in a job, they may also be eligible for benefits from their employer's workers' compensation program. This type of insurance pays for legal and medical expenses. It can also pay for lost wages due to illness. However, these payments can't be used to pay for treatments that are not covered by the insurance of the worker.

Asbestos victims who are not able to work may also apply for disability benefits through the Social Security Administration. These benefits can be used to replace lost income and help pay for essential expenses such as transportation and treatment costs. Veterans' benefits

Many veterans diagnosed with m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related diseases may be qualified for compensation. This compensation could include monthly disability payments, medical treatment and travel costs to mesothelioma treatment centers. A mesothelioma attorney can help veterans determine the VA claim and compensation options are appropriate for their situation. The type of mesothelioma a veteran has and their income level could affect their the benefits they are eligible for.

The VA offers a number of programs for veterans suffering from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ses. These include disability compensation, 0522445518.ussoft.kr pension and travel benefits. Disability compensation is a monthly tax-free amount that is determined based on the extent of the veteran's mesothelioma and service-related disability. In general, veterans who have mesothelioma-related cancers that have a 100% disability rating or higher get the highest amount of monthly compensation.

Veterans suffering from mesothelioma with a service-connected disabilities are eligible to receive free treatment at the West Los Angeles VA Medical Center. Additionally, the VA provides housing and transportation to and from the mesothelioma specialist. Veterans have received free mesothelioma treatment and extended their lives and quality of living.

Certain veterans might be eligible for Aid and Attendance or a housebound benefit. This benefit allows veterans to pay for a caregiver when they require assistance with everyday activities such as bathing and dressing. Certain veterans have a late-stage diagnosis and are sick and bedridden. This benefit can be used to pay for home health aide or nursing care.
